[计算机类试卷]国家二级VF机试(操作题)模拟试卷152及答案与解析.doc
《[计算机类试卷]国家二级VF机试(操作题)模拟试卷152及答案与解析.doc》由会员分享,可在线阅读,更多相关《[计算机类试卷]国家二级VF机试(操作题)模拟试卷152及答案与解析.doc(10页珍藏版)》请在麦多课文档分享上搜索。
1、国家二级 VF机试(操作题)模拟试卷 152及答案与解析 一、基本操作题 1 在考生文件夹下,完成如下操作: (1)打开考生文件夹下的表单 one,如下图所示,编写 “显示 ”命令按钮的 Click事件代码,使表单运行时单击该命令按钮则在Text1文本框中显示当前系统日期的年份 (提示:通过设置文本框的 Value属性实现,系统日期函数是 date(),年份函数是 year()。 (2)打开考生文件夹下的表单 two,如下图所示,选择 “表单 ”菜单中的 “新建方法程序 ”命令,在 “新建方法程序 ”对话框中,为该表单新建一个 test方法,然后双击表单,选择该方法编写代码,该方法的功能是使
2、“测试 ”按钮变为不可用,即将该按钮的 Enabled属性设置为 F。 (3)创建一个名为study_report的快速报表,报表包含表 “课程表 ”中的所有字段。 (4)为 “教师表 ”的 “职工号 ”字段增加有效性规则:职工号左边 3位字符是 110,表达式为: LEFT(职工号, 3)=”110”。 2 在考生文件夹下完成如下简单应用: (1)打开 “课程管理 ”数据库,使用 SQL语句建立一个视图 salary,该视图包括系号和平均工资两个字段,并且按平均工资降序排列 。将该 SQL语句存储在 four prg文件中。 (2)打开考生文件夹下的表单 six,如下图所示, “登录 ”命令
3、按钮的功能是:当用户输入用户名和口令以后,单击 “登录 ”按钮时,程序在自由表 “用户表 ”中进行查找,若找不到相应的用户名,则提示“用户名错误 ”,若用户名输入正确,而口令输入错误,则提示 “口令错误 ”。修改“登录 ”命令按钮 Click事件中标有错误的语句,使其能够正确运行。 (注意:不得做其他修改。 ) 3 在考生文件夹下完成下列操作: (1)建立一个表单名和文件名均为 myform的表单,如下图所示。表单的标题 为 “教师情况 ”,表单中有两个命令按钮 (Command1和 Command2),两个复选框 (Check1和 Check2)和两个单选按钮 (Option1和Option
4、2)。 Command1和 Com-mand2的标题分别是 “生成表 ”和 “退出 ”, Check1和Check2的标题分别是 “系名 ”和 “工资 ”, Option1和 Option2的标题分别是 “按职工号升序 ”和 “按职工号降序 ”。 (2)为 “生成表 ”命令按钮编写 Click事件代码,其功能是根据表单运行时复选框指定的字段和单选钮指定的排序方式生成新的自由表。如果两个复选 框都被选中,生成的自由表命名为two dbf, two dbf的字段包括职工号、姓名、系名、工资和课程号;如果只有“系名 ”复选框被选中,生成的自由表命名为 one-X dbf, one_x dbf的字段包
5、括职工号、姓名、系名和课程号;如果只有 “工资 ”复选框被选中,生成的自由表命名为one_xx dbf, one_xx dbf的字段包括职工号、姓名、工资和课程号。 (3)运行表单,并分别执行如下操作: 选中两个复选框和 “按职工号升序 ”单选钮,单击 “生成表 ”命令按钮。 只选中 “系名 ”复选框和 “按职工号降序 ”单选钮, 单击 “生成表 ”命令按钮。 只选中 “工资 ”复选框和 “按职工号降序 ”单选钮,单击 “生成表 ”命令按钮。 国家二级 VF机试(操作题)模拟试卷 152答案与解析 一、基本操作题 1 【正确答案】 (1)利用 “文件 ”菜单下的 “打开 ”命令来打开表单 on
6、e,或使用命令“MODIFY FORM One”打开表单 one。在 “显示 ”命令按钮的 Click事件中输入代码“thisform text1 value=year(date()”,如图 3 105所示。保存并运行修改后的表单,查看运行结果。 (2)打开表单 two,在 “表单 ”菜单中选择 “新建方法程序 ”命令,新建一个名为 test的方法。在属性窗口中双击此方法,在弹出的窗口中编写用户自定义过程代码“ThisForm Command1 Enabled= F ”,在表单设计器环境下双击 “测试 ”命令按钮,编写 Click事件代码 “ThisForm Test”,如图 3 106所示。
7、保存并运行修改后的表单,查看运行结果。 (3)创建一个快速报表,如图 3 107所示。预览该报表,查看设计后的效果。(4)在命令窗口输入命令 “alter table教师表 alter职工号 set check LEFT(职工号, 3)=“110”,按下回车键。 【试题解析】 本大题主要考查的知识点是:日期函数的使用,为表单创建方法,创建快速报表,以及通过 SQL语句修改表结构。 【解题思路】打开表单,在表单设计器环境下修改控件的相关属性,为命令按钮编写 Click事件代码;在 “新建方法程序 ”对话框中为表单新建方法;在报表设计器中创建快速报表;通过 ALTER TABLE命令为字段增加有效
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
本资源只提供5页预览,全部文档请下载后查看!喜欢就下载吧,查找使用更方便
2000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 试卷 国家 二级 VF 机试 操作 模拟 152 答案 解析 DOC
